The inspector’s account

LPA Hansen conducted an unannounced annual required inspection and met with Program Manager Yasmin Boroumand. There are 35 clients enrolled in the program. The program has 26 clients & 9 staff working at the time of the visit.

LPA toured the facility on 4/25/2024 at 9:10 AM with Program Manager Yasmin Boroumand; facility was found to be clean and at a comfortable temperature with all exits free from obstruction. LPA toured building and grounds, day activity rooms, kitchen, offices, and bathrooms. Fire extinguishers are fully charged and current while last inspection dated 2/12/2024. Smoke detectors were tested and found to be in working order. Facility has a pull station that is tested bi-annually. Carbon Monoxide detector was tested and working. Toxins and cleaning supplies are stored in supply room closet that was found open during tour on 4/25/2024 at 9:26am (see pic & LIC809-D) Program Director closed and locked door and advised staff to keep it locked. Activity rooms had staff supervising art projects. Bathrooms were all equipped with wall mounted soap dispensers and individual paper towels. There is a sufficient supply of sanitary products on hand. Hot water temperature measured between 110.4 degrees F & 120.7 degrees F in 2 of 2 bathrooms used by clients. Day program is having one hot water heater turned down. Clients provide their own snacks and lunches but program will supply food for special occasions. There is one large refrigerator available for client food storage and another refrigerator for staff.

A sample review of five client & five staff records was also completed during visit on 4/25/2024. LPA reviewed 5 out of 35 client records and found files to be thorough and contain current client care assessments and individualized Service Plans. LPA reviewed five staff records on 4/25/2024 at 10:50 AM and learned that all facility staff and other individuals who require caregiver background checks have received criminal record clearances or exemptions.
